How to Play the Don't Pass Bar in Casino Craps

    • 1). Know that a Don't Pass bet means you are betting against the shooter. In craps, a shooter's first roll is known as his "come out roll." On this roll, you want the shooter to roll a two or three. If he does, you will win your Don't Pass bet.

    • 2). Place your bet on the Don't Pass bar prior to a shooter's come out roll. If the shooter has already completed her first roll, you cannot bet on the Don't Pass bar. This bet is known as a self-service one, meaning you can put the chips on the Don't Pass bar yourself.

    • 3). Be aware that you will win your Don't Pass bet if the shooter rolls a two or three on his come out roll. If the shooter rolls a 12, you will neither win nor lose. This is known as a "push" and you will get to simply keep your original bet.

    • 4). Remove your money from the Don't Pass line, if you wish, provided the shooter rolls a point on his initial roll. While you can't place a bet on the Don't Pass line after the come out roll, you can remove your bet if the shooter rolls a point. If you do not remove your bet and the shooter rolls the same point again, you will lose your bet. If you leave your bet on the Don't Pass line and the shooter rolls a seven, you will win.

    • 5). Know that you cannot raise your Don't Pass bet after the come out roll. Whatever amount of money you put down initially is what has to remain after the dice has been rolled. This is because the odds are now in your favor rather than the casino's favor.
